How Much Is Aromatherapy?
An average aromatherapy session can cost anywhere from $45 to $110. Oils range in price from $5 to $165, depending on the ingredients used, the region plant matter originates from, and the method of extraction.
Why Is Aromatherapy Expensive? One of the reasons why some essential oils are expensive than others is due to the cost and complicated production processes. … The rarity of the plant, the region where the source is grown or the difficult conditions of growing a certain plant makes that essential oil very expensive than another.

Is Aromatherapy Covered By Insurance? Does health insurance cover aromatherapy? In general, no. Health insurance plans in the US usually don't cover aromatherapy or essential oil therapy. Actually, it's rare for most health plans to cover any type of complementary or alternative medicine.

How Much Is A Drop Of Essential Oil?
There are approximately 20 drops in 1 milliliter. These measurements should be considered estimates. Not all essential oil drops are equal; differences in viscosity will impact the volume of an oil that holds together in a drop.

Are Holistic Doctors Real Doctors?
Holistic medicine is a whole-body approach to healthcare. … Other holistic practitioners are not “real” medical doctors. They may be called “doctor” in their field, but they aren't licensed to practice medicine. In general, holistic medicine isn't meant to be used in place of traditional medical care.

Is Holistic Medicine Covered By Medicare?
Although Original Medicare (Medicare Part A and Part B) does not cover holistic medicine, some Medicare Advantage (Part C) plans may cover other treatments, therapies and medicines that Original Medicare doesn't cover.

How Many Drops Should You Put In A Diffuser?
Between 3 to 5 drops of an essential oil are recommended to use in a diffuser, if the diffuser's size is 100 ml. So 3 drops is a standard amount that can be used as a trial, if you are using an aroma diffuser for the first time.

Are Essential Oils Edible?
Many essential oils are suitable for use as a flavoring and are safe for human consumption. … The essential oils that LorAnn Oils labels as food grade (edible) are approved by a regulation of the FDA (a classification known as GRAS) or appear on the industry approved register of safe ingredients for the flavor industry.
